The transcript discusses the F35 fighter jet's software deficiencies, with over 800 issues identified by the Defense Department. Despite these flaws, the Pentagon's assessment did not highlight new problems with the jet's flying capabilities. Lockheed Martin believes the F35 is improving in reliability and remains a top fighter. A 2018 report noted nearly 1000 defects, but Congress continues to increase F35 orders.
